Kitchen Renovations

A modern, well-designed kitchen is often the deal-maker for prospective buyers. Many people prioritize updated kitchens, especially those with open layouts, premium appliances, and thoughtful storage solutions. A beautifully designed kitchen signals quality throughout the home.

Incorporating smart technology into your kitchen remodel is something modern homebuyers expect. From voice-activated lighting to connected appliances, smart kitchens are quickly becoming a must-have upgrade that adds significant appeal and value by showcasing forward-thinking home design.

Spa-Inspired Bathrooms

Modern bathrooms offer more than just utility; they also provide a personal retreat. The trend of creating relaxing, spa-like bathrooms continues to grow, particularly in primary suites. Features such as heated floors, elegant frameless glass showers, and stylish double vanities are high-value amenities that attract premium buyers.

Even smaller updates, such as luxury fixtures or sophisticated tile upgrades, can significantly elevate a bathroom’s appeal. When staged correctly, an upscale bathroom evokes a boutique hotel experience that resonates deeply with buyers seeking comfort and luxury.

Additions and Flexible Spaces

Dedicated home offices, private guest suites, and accessory dwelling units (ADUs) are highly desirable flexible spaces in modern homes. A well-planned addition not only increases your home’s square footage but also its overall usability. This can directly impact its price per square foot.

Features such as custom built-ins, unique finishes, and integrated smart systems elevate these spaces from simple extra rooms to standout, high-value features that capture buyers’ imaginations. These high-end renovations that boost your home’s resale value cater directly to modern lifestyle needs.

Finishing Touches

Upgraded entryways, meticulous landscaping, and modern exterior materials significantly enhance curb appeal and invite buyers inside. High-end light fixtures and updated hardware throughout the home’s interior subtly suggest that the entire property has been maintained with exceptional care. These details, though small, collectively create a powerful perception of quality and luxury that buyers notice and appreciate.
